The Prophet’s estate is charity, not inheritance
[AI] that he adjured Talhah, al-Zubayr, Ali, and al-Abbas—Allah have mercy on them—saying, "Do you know that the Messenger of Allah ﷺ said, "We are not inherited from; what we leave is charity."?" They said, "Yes." Others besides Amr supported Amr in a narration like this from al-Zuhri, so we were satisfied with Amr from al-Zuhri since he was trustworthy. This hadith was narrated by Ikrimah ibn Khalid and Muhammad ibn al-Munkadir from Malik ibn Aws from Umar, and they did not mention it from Abu Bakr. Malik ibn Anas is a hafiz, and he added to those whom we have named, and the addition of a hafiz is accepted when he adds it over a hafiz, for he only added it by virtue of the excellence of his memory. A group also narrated it from Abu Bakr from the Prophet ﷺ, among them Aishah, Abu Hurayrah, and others.
